Michael Smith survives match darts for third game in a row and reaches last four at World Series Finals
In the ninth leg, Cross threw out 43, and then the 33-year-old Englishman provided the equalizer with a 12-darter. After the final break, Smith again created a gap. A 75 finish and a 12-darter made it 7-5 for Smith, who then missed four chances to make it 8-5. Cross took advantage and returned to 6-7 via double 4.
